Winemaker's Notes:


Bottle of Sangiovese Sangiovese 2005

Dry Red Wine

Named after the grape with which the wine is made, Sangiovese is a medium-bodied dry red wine with deep, rich, luscious, black cherry-like flavors. Aged in stainless steel to retain its youth and fruit, Sangiovese is bottled with our newest closure, the screwcap and is a perfect example of how this new closure will help retain the wine’s fresh flavors.

This wine is among a new trend of grapey ready-to-drink red wines. The deep flavors of the wine pairs with grilled foods and the screwcap closure will make it handy to take on a picnic and leave the corkscrew at home.

Grape: 100% Sangiovese, custom-grown in Washington state

Production Method: Uncrushed and destemmed, whole berry fermentation

Aging: no barrel-aging, bottled early spring

Sweetness: dry

Alcohol: 13%

Serving Temperature: 50º - 55º

Ageability: 2 to 3 years

History: started making Sangiovese in 2005

The Wollersheim Winery sits on a scenic hillside overlooking the Wisconsin River, just across from Prairie du Sac, Wisconsin. This national historic site was selected by European vintners over 150 years ago and is one of America's oldest winery properties. Established as the Wollersheim Winery in 1972, today the vineyards are comprised of 25 acres of French-American hybrid grapes. This regional winery has received numerous Double Gold awards for its premium grape wines and has gained recognition as being one of the leading wineries in the Midwest.
